THESE Could Harm Your Squash Birds, Squirrels, Rabbits, & Chipmunks: These pests will generally not harm your actual squash vegetables. WebbCause: Lack of moisture in the soil. Cure: Water deeply, thoroughly. Water when soil is dry to a depth of 3 or more inches. Cause: Too much water; poor drainage; waterlogged soil. Cure: Stop watering; improve drainage. Cause: Disease. Cure: Grow disease-resistant varieties. Keep the garden free of weeds and clean.

Webb27 maj 2024 · To start your garden, use a general vegetable fertilizer. For vegetables, we use an herb and vegetable plant food with a 3-4-4 number. For tomatoes, we use a separate fertlize with a 3-4-6 ration which also contains calcium to help prevent blossom-end rot.
